I really enjoyed this book, especially the humor and sarcasm. One needs to laugh in order to garden! As a life-long gardener, it is nice to have a great book like this to refresh my gardening pores. All of the advice is sound and holistic. As I live in a very harsh climate, I need to interpret gardening advice to fit my life - just like all of you! This book definitely has the structure for tending perennials - just adapt it for your situations. One of the best pieces of advice is to mimic nature in your area - if God planted it here in nature, it is sure to thrive in your yard! Many of her mulching techniques are very adaptable for maintaining gardens in times of drought and harsh winters. I also enjoy her idea of pest control through predatory insects. I do wish she had a chapter on planting for pollinators and butterflies - 2 areas of environmental concern that are attractively addressed by perennials. This book is great for novice through expert; both as reference and instruction. This will be on my 'keeper' shelf. I know I will read it again in the dark of winter. Enjoy!


Author Information

Rosefiend Cordell (aka Melinda R. Cordell) worked in most all aspects of horticulture - in garden centers, in wholesale greenhouses, as a landscape designer, and finally as city horticulturist, where she took care of 20+ gardens around the city. She lives in northwest Missouri with her husband and kids, the best little family that ever walked the earth, as well as two hens and a couple roses and a lot of weeds. She hates weeding so much. You can't even imagine. My first gardening book is Don't Throw in the Trowel: Vegetable Gardening Month by Month. That was followed up by the rosarian-approved Rose to the Occasion: An Easy-Growing Guide to Rose Gardening, and recently, If You're a Tomato, I'll Ketchup With You: Tomato Gardening Tips and Tricks.
